1、int x,y;采用上面兩個方法都可以讓程序正常運行。
創(chuàng)新互聯(lián)是一家集網(wǎng)站建設(shè),日照企業(yè)網(wǎng)站建設(shè),日照品牌網(wǎng)站建設(shè),網(wǎng)站定制,日照網(wǎng)站建設(shè)報價,網(wǎng)絡(luò)營銷,網(wǎng)絡(luò)優(yōu)化,日照網(wǎng)站推廣為一體的創(chuàng)新建站企業(yè),幫助傳統(tǒng)企業(yè)提升企業(yè)形象加強企業(yè)競爭力??沙浞譂M足這一群體相比中小企業(yè)更為豐富、高端、多元的互聯(lián)網(wǎng)需求。同時我們時刻保持專業(yè)、時尚、前沿,時刻以成就客戶成長自我,堅持不斷學(xué)習(xí)、思考、沉淀、凈化自己,讓我們?yōu)楦嗟钠髽I(yè)打造出實用型網(wǎng)站。
2、main函數(shù)里讀取x的值的時候,要用%lf,因為x是double型,如果是float型,則是用%f。你試試。
3、抱歉,剛才有兩個分號是用中文輸入法輸入的,導(dǎo)致C無法識別。語句結(jié)束要加分號。1=x10要分開寫。條件語句后面若不只一句,要用{}括起來。你的y之前沒有定義。
4、都是-2啊。。不要因此得出結(jié)論x=-1的時候y=2x 另外,你這個函數(shù)如果用if就全用if,如果用if--else-if,就全部這樣,不要混合用,很亂。建議都用if--else if,這樣能夠看出是一個分段函數(shù)。
5、你這個題是ACM的題目?我看了下你的程序,正經(jīng)的數(shù)字是可以的,但你說錯了,那就該就是要考慮極限情況了。譬如x=0.0000000000000000000000000000000001的時候,你的程序輸出是100.0。。應(yīng)該就是出錯在這里了。
6、你這個題是ACM的題目?我看了下你的 程序 ,正經(jīng)的 數(shù)字 是可以的,但你說錯了,那就該就是要考慮極限情況了。譬如x=0.0000000000000000000000000000000001的時候,你的程序輸出是100.0。。應(yīng)該就是出錯在這里了。
//第if語句連續(xù)使用,只執(zhí)行成功的那一個,如果后面有,就不會再執(zhí)行了。 //第不用每次都printf(x=%d,y=%d,x,y);,在最后就可以了。以上是我修改的。我還發(fā)現(xiàn)你的 (x0)前面沒有if 保留字。
因為分段函數(shù)需要對定義域范圍進行判定,所以需要用到級聯(lián)式if else語句。
if(條件1 )f=函數(shù)表達式1;else if(條件2 )f=函數(shù)表達式2;else if( 條件3 )f=函數(shù)表達式3;...就這樣寫。
幫你改了下代碼,VC6測試通過,自己看看吧。
1、函數(shù)公式:=IF(測試條件,真值,[假值])函數(shù)解釋:當(dāng)?shù)?個參數(shù)“測試條件”成立時,返回第2個參數(shù),不成立時返回第3個參數(shù)。IF函數(shù)可以層層嵌套,來解決多個分枝邏輯。
2、首先在Excel表格中輸入一組數(shù)據(jù),需要根據(jù)分段條件設(shè)置函數(shù)計算結(jié)果。在B1單元格中輸入分段函數(shù)的公式,可以使用IF函數(shù),具體函數(shù)可見下圖單元格輸入的公式。
3、輸入的參數(shù)太多,建議改成代碼來計算吧。功能是一樣的,方便的話把文件發(fā)給我,我把您來完成。
1、因為分段函數(shù)需要對定義域范圍進行判定,所以需要用到級聯(lián)式if else語句。
2、double f(double x){ double fx = 0.0;if (x=0)fx = 3*x+5;else if (x = 1)fx = x+5;else fx = -2*x+8;return fx;} 在需要計算該分段函數(shù)的地方調(diào)用即可,其他分段函數(shù)實現(xiàn)類似。
3、//第if語句連續(xù)使用,只執(zhí)行成功的那一個,如果后面有,就不會再執(zhí)行了。 //第不用每次都printf(x=%d,y=%d,x,y);,在最后就可以了。以上是我修改的。我還發(fā)現(xiàn)你的 (x0)前面沒有if 保留字。